Firefox is going to get rid of RSS and Atom Feeds
Firefox has announced that they are going to discontinue support for RSS and Atom Feeds sometime between October and December 2018. Do not install Firefox Focus for iOS 9
Mozilla has just released a browser based plugin for iOS 9 called Focus. This plugin puts users in control of their privacy by allowing them to block categories of trackers such as those used for ads, analytics and social media. The app will block the same content as Firefox's Private Browsing with Tracking Protection feature on Windows, Mac, Linux and Android. Firefox for Android Now Supports Language Switching, History Clearing
In case you weren't convinced that Firefox was a good alternative browser to use on your Android device, a new version has introduced a number of new features that make it even more competitive. The latest update lets you switch quickly between the browser's 55 supported languages as well as being even easier to clear the app's browsing history. Chromecast Support Extends to Firefox
For those watching the evolution and growth of Chromecast closely, the latest nightly build of the Firefox web browser now supports the technology. Once you upgrade to the latest version of the popular browser, you can easily cast tabs or videos from any Android device to any available Chromecast located on the same network. FireFox For Windows 8 Project Axed Due to Low Demand
Mozilla has announced they have put an end to the Firefox for Windows 8 project just weeks of launching the beta version because there just aren’t enough testers who volunteered to test the new touch-friendly Metro avatar of Firefox. Mozilla also stated they are not going to risk launching what could be a buggy version of the browser. The Archos 9 Tablet PC
It’s not exactly a 9 inch screen that makes up the Archos 9 Tablet PC, though at 8.9 inches, it’s very much close to it. The Archos 9 runs the Windows 7 operating system, which means it is capable of running any of the thousands of Windows program that exists on line or in the market.
